19.59 (2018)
OpenDoes the group of isometries of $\mathbb{Q}^3$ have a free non-abelian subgroup such that every non-trivial element acts without nontrivial fixed points in $\mathbb{Q}^3$?
The answer is yes if the field of rational numbers $\mathbb{Q}$ is replaced by the field $\mathbb{R}$ of real numbers (see G. Tomkowicz, S. Wagon, The Banach–Tarski Paradox, Cambridge Univ. Press, 2016.)
